Before Migrating a Mock-Up Solid into CATIA V5

 

 

After the Copy/Paste AS SPEC of a V3 SolidM in CATIA V5, the update fails because the contour of the primitive is not closed.

For the migration of a V3 Mock-Up Solid into CATIA V5, you first need to migrate it into CATIA V4 by using the /m solm34 function on the model in CATIA V4. This function allows you to convert the model into format V4 and then, create a good contour of the primitive. After this operation, the migration forward CATIA V5 is successful.

This task shows you how to launch the macro before migrating and how this tool makes a Mock-Up Solid validity (on contours) before copying it to CATIA Version 5. You can get all the specifications of the Solid in CATIA V5.

   
Before migrating, to improve resolution (on contours), it is recommended to launch the solm34 macro:
  • Tape < /m  solm34 > in the text field

  • UPDATE (YES) the solids - in the model -

  • Save the model

 

An automatic compatibility check has occurred on the V3 Solids to be transferred into CATIA V4 and they can be migrated into CATIA V5. You obtain a Solid Exact or a Part with all its specifications in CATIA V5.

If you do not UPDATE the Solid, you may translate an unstable Solid.
